Output e1f4e985df3b26ec56d97f1bae238c70836b42ab19e4e8abe2d5a87ea4ec74cb:177

value
37403
script pubkey
OP_0 OP_PUSHBYTES_20 3ba015b8844ec0e314aaaa12d7f774dadc8da96e
address
bc1q8wsptwyyfmqwx9924gfd0am5mtwgm2twautcx2
transaction
e1f4e985df3b26ec56d97f1bae238c70836b42ab19e4e8abe2d5a87ea4ec74cb
spent
true